Art History and Processes Workshops
for ages 9-15
Weekly Tuesdays 10-11.30
Running since 2020, this workshop covers art history eras in detail. During each cycle we study movements and artists: their life stories, stories behind pieces, historical and political background, while discovering the web of art history, which is not linear but cross-curricula and always blending.
All cycles covered from prehistory to contemporary, then rotating it with more detail and depth throughout the years.

Fortnightly Friday Workshops
10-11.30
for ages 10+
This workshop caters for drawing skills from basics to advanced ones. Along with fundamental and master exercises we emphasise learning to see and discuss elements of art throughout art history. From philosophy to science we learn about perspective, light, shadow, even photography.
